The meaning and "use of": vagabonds

noun
  • a person who wanders from place to place without a home or job. - Vagabond Tales is loosely based around the adventures of a musical vagabond who travels around the world and through time to bring different kinds of music back to the traveling minstrels of Barrage.
verb
  • wander about as or like a vagabond. - At home most of the time, I would bundle my baby in his stroller and go vagabonding as and when the weather would allow.
